We have just been advised by one of the other dealers that 1 of the Winter Tire packages DO NOT FIT the Stinger.

Please be advised the K022 in 18" will not fit on the Front end of the Stinger, waiting on resolution from dealer currently dealing with the issue, will advise once updated.

Could possibly be all 18" packages.

Okay so update on solution as final production vehicle front axel specs were different than the p2 vehicles they had.
After some further investigation on pending issues regarding the K022 application on the front axle on the new Stinger, there is clearly a difference between the P2 vehicle Fastco Canada mapped and the current production vehicle that we are installing the K022 (+45 offset) on as it does not fit.


Until further notice, please restrict the application on the K022 to the +34 offset ONLY (not +45) as this offset offers the most clearance. The +34 offset wheel requires the use of low profile wheel weights.


Fastco Canada is completely aware of the situation at hand and working on a solution – Also, if not already completed, Fastco Canada be in contact with any dealers whom have purchased the K022 for the Stinger application to assist with returns and reorders.
